Jesus’ disciples had a misconception of what defines greatness in God’s Heavenly Kingdom. In their minds, position and power characterized Kingdom greatness, just like they do on earth. This is a trap 21st Century Christians can easily fall into as well. So what does it mean to be great in the Kingdom of God? Dustin Renz answers that question out of Mark 10 in this week’s message.

Dustin Renz

Dustin Renz is a graduate of Southeastern University. Prior to entering Pure Life Ministries in April 2011, he and his wife, Brittany, served as Missionary Associates in Macedonia. At Pure Life, he had a life-changing encounter with God that radically altered his life, including his marriage and ministry. He currently serves as a missionary-evangelist and the President of Make Way Ministries and is the author of Pile of Masks and The Crucified Lifestyle. He resides in Kettering, Ohio with wife, Brittany and his three daughters, Abigail Claire and Isabelle.
